Output 71b303eccc80fa280df664208fa516470415aabb3f5342f065530e285223e5ff:55

value
323614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 759bb70929f7fc7a4b481973849ae629434695cd OP_EQUAL
address
3CQsXFitG41KNpr4p6qC9xDvhJNXd39V5P
transaction
71b303eccc80fa280df664208fa516470415aabb3f5342f065530e285223e5ff
spent
true